Transaction 1684ae2296a0257cfde6219f7ddb1dd4e38d6bb2b35788036ace4153a8024d3f
1 Input
1 Output
-
1684ae2296a0257cfde6219f7ddb1dd4e38d6bb2b35788036ace4153a8024d3f:0
- value
- 6368731
- script pubkey
- OP_0 OP_PUSHBYTES_20 9431da36814fae439f21b09c53002250ee27264e
- address
- bc1qjsca5d5pf7hy88epkzw9xqpz2rhzwfjwjnlld8